abstract = "The goal of this work is to apply Bayesian statistics to the
problem of pulsars in order to compute the Bayes factor and
investigate which one among different EoS could better fit known
pulsar data, regarding the rate of decrease of the angular
velocity versus the angular velocity itself. We also find the
posterior distribution and the best fit for some relevant
parameters of the pulsar like the mass and the magnetic field.",
